8 December 2007: Wadhurst Walk

A 7 mile walk through the unspoiled countryside of the High Weald, in East Sussex. This is a circular walk from Wadhurst Station, with a pub lunch at the Old Vine in Cousley Wood. One of a series of popular monthly walks organised by Gerry.

A simple seven-mile walk for December, starting and finishing in Wadhurst, East Sussex. There will be a pub lunch at the Old Vine, in Cousley Wood. The route follows the Sussex Border Path to the large reservoir of Bewl Water, and then follows its banks back to Wadhurst village for tea. This is beautiful country, full of hidden valleys and picturesque farms. Being the Weald, the route is almost never flat, but the gradients on this route are always gentle.

Wadhurst is a pleasant village set on a ridge and has many attractive weatherboarded or tiled houses. The village was once one of the most flourishing of the iron-smelting centres of the Weald.

The Parish Church of St Peter and St Paul, Wadhurst, dates from the 11th century. It is famous for 31 iron tomb slabs dating 1617 to 1799, a greater number than any other church in England, reflecting Wadhurst's connection with the Wealden iron industry. The church has a Norman tower with a pretty needle spire. In the west window of the south aisle there is glass designed by Burne-Jones and made by William Morris.
